Drip beer makers
A drip brewer is a popular option for those who want to make their own coffee at home. It is simple to use, simple to clean and produces delicious results. With this brewing system, you can customize the taste of your coffee by altering the amount of ground coffee and water used. This system works with different types and temperatures of coffee beans.
A standard drip coffee maker comes with a reservoir for the water, a heating element that makes it boil and a tubing that connects the hot water to the pot. It also comes with showerheads that allow water to flow over grounds to extract their flavors. Certain models have an electronic display that allows you to choose from several recipes that have been pre-programmed. Some models have touchscreens that help you determine the temperature of water and brew time.
The first step in making a cup of coffee is filling the reservoir of water with the amount you want. Add the grounds of coffee to the filter basket, and then add the filter. You can choose to use paper or metal filters, based on your preference. You can also use an reusable filter, however it will take longer for the water to move through the soil.
After you've added the grounds of the coffee, you are able to start the machine. After that, you'll need to wait for the coffee to brew. Pour the coffee into a mug or carafe. It's important to note that if you don't make use of the right amount of ground coffee, the result will not be as delicious.
Drip coffee brewing is similar to pour-over making however it's a process that is automated. Pour-over beer makers
Pour-over brewing is an increasingly popular method of making coffee that offers a great degree of control over brewing variables. This method results in a stronger cup than drip machines and has a more pleasant taste. It's relatively cheap, and it works well with almost any type of filter. Additionally, it is easy to clean and requires very few parts. As a result, it is perfect for coffee lovers who like to make their own world-class cups at home.
Pour-over brewers generally require paper filters that are specifically designed to fit the dimensions of the device. They are sold in the coffee aisles at grocery stores. However, some customers prefer using disposable ceramic or metal filters. If you're considering buying a pour-over device, read reviews to find out how simple it is to use and the outcomes it can bring.
Pour-over coffee makers involves placing ground coffee into the filter and slowly pouring hot water over the coffee grounds. This process is referred to as blooming, and it helps to activate the coffee grounds' acidic compounds as well as caffeine molecules. After the blooming process is complete, hot water will prepare your beans for brewing into carafe or coffee cup. It is important to use the correct amount of water to make the brew, and it is recommended to weigh your desired amount before you begin brewing.
Pour-over brewers are excellent because they permit you to regulate the speed and direction of water pouring. Pour-over machines are different from drip pots that have automatic controls that can spray water unevenly on the grounds, are more likely to distribute evenly water. This ensures that all areas of the grounds receive the same amount of saturation, resulting in a balanced and delicious cup of coffee.
Pour-over brewers can be found in a variety of styles including single-serve and multi-serve. Pod brewers
Pod coffee makers allow you to make a quick cup. They use capsules that are pre-filled with coffee (also known as pods) to create an even cup. They are convenient and provide an all-in-one brewing system. They come in various flavors. Some of the top-rated coffee pods come with additional features such as the ability to froth milk and make strong or frozen coffee.
The ideal pod machine for your family will depend on both your personal preferences as well as your family's requirements. If you're a busy family it is important to consider how much maintenance you can perform each day. A good pod machine should require only minimal cleaning and descaling and must have an receptacle that doesn't permit the user to get their hands wet or sticky. It should also have simple instructions for cleaning and descaling.
Another aspect to consider is how much personalization you'd like to see in your coffee. The pod-based coffee makers are made to make just one cup at a given time, so they're not ideal for families that need to brew multiple cups on different times.
